I lived in N.E England in ’40’s/50’s. During and After the war.
Old Coronation st 2 up 2 down terraced council houses.

I Remember. In winter. Snow drifts at certain angles.
They built up to over upstairs window ledges.
We used to open the windows.
Wooden boards. and slide down to street.
Also go along beach with Coal rake. Bags, and old bike.
Raking up the “Seacoal” after the tide from coal dock.
Wrap in wet newpaper. dry out. Made coal blocks.
and feed a really nice FREE fire in living room.
Plus sell them at a Tanner each.(6d). or 2 bob a bag.
The good old days hey.
Had everything but food. clothes and money. Everything Rationed
in those days.
Winning…… The war. was NOT a good thing for residents.
